Ukraine's 2026 Defense Budget Surges by 63.5%
Sharp Increase in Security and Defense Funding for Ukraine in 2026
According to Главком: Ukraine's Cabinet of Ministers has approved a significant boost to security and defense spending for 2026. The total defense budget for next year is set at 4.367 trillion hryvnias, marking a 63.5% increase compared to 2025. This decision stems from the urgent need to strengthen the country's defensive capabilities amid ongoing challenges. For context, this budget increase comes as Ukraine continues to face sustained military pressure and seeks to modernize its armed forces.
In 2025, defense allocations stood at 2.67 trillion hryvnias. The additional 1.56 trillion hryvnias for 2026 will enable Ukraine to access the first tranche of a €45 billion aid package from the European Union. Of this EU assistance, €13.2 billion is designated for budgetary support, while €31.8 billion is earmarked for defense needs. These EU funds are structured as a loan, with repayment planned through future reparations from Russia.
Key Expenditure Items in the Defense Budget
The 2026 defense budget outlines several major spending categories:
- 174.3 billion hryvnias for military personnel allowances;
- 1.371 trillion hryvnias for the purchase and repair of weapons, equipment, and ammunition;
- 14.6 billion hryvnias for the security and defense sector reserve.
Starting July 1, 2026, revenue from the military levy will be directed into a special state budget fund for payments to Ukrainian Armed Forces personnel. The government has also endorsed a plan to channel proceeds from additional export duties on military and dual-use goods toward funding the army and the defense-industrial complex.
Furthermore, the Cabinet is allocating 96 million hryvnias from the reserve fund to construct anti-drone structures in Kherson and along evacuation routes in the region. This funding is part of a broader strategy to enhance Ukraine's security and defense posture in the current environment.
The expansion of Ukraine's defense budget underscores the nation's imperative to bolster its defensive capabilities amid protracted military conflicts and emerging threats.
The mobilization of financing from the European Union, with a substantial portion dedicated to defense, highlights the support of international allies. This move also reflects Ukraine's strategic approach to ensuring security and addressing the challenges confronting the country.
The recent approval of a substantial increase in Ukraine's defense budget reflects a broader strategy to enhance national security amid persistent threats.
